So, who falls under the category of exemption?

Firstly, individuals aged above 80 years find themselves excluded from this obligation. Additionally, as per the Income Tax Act, non-residents or those lacking Indian citizenship need not concern themselves with linking their PAN cards. Furthermore, residents of Assam, Jammu and Kashmir, and Meghalaya are also off the hook. This leniency in these regions stems from the fact that failure to link PAN with Aadhaar leads to deactivation.

Failure to comply with the PAN Aadhaar link mandate bears consequences. Those who haven’t linked their PAN with Aadhaar cannot file income tax returns, execute bank transactions, or avail themselves of various government schemes.
